2017-12-11 6 views
-1

enter image description here인 IntelliJ '셀레늄'

내가 명령 줄을 통해 셀레늄을 설치하고 인 IntelliJ에 라이브러리를 가져올라는 이름의 모듈. 언뜻보기에 소프트웨어가 "unused import statement"를 반환하기 때문에 문제가되지 않습니다. 불행히도 모듈을 어떤 식 으로든 사용하면 오류가 반환됩니다. C에서 셀레늄 : 없음 모듈은 '셀레늄'

내가 다시 pip install selenium을 시도하고,

요구 사항 이미 만족있어 이름이 없다 \ 사용자 \ 사용자 \ APPDATA \ 로컬 \ 프로그램 \ 파이썬 \ python36-32 \ 같은 오류를 반환

import selenium 

help(selenium) 

: LIB \ 사이트 - 패키지

이것은 내가 실행하려고 한 코드입니다. 그것은 내가 무작위로 가져 오기를 바로 쓰기 할 것인지처럼 코드를 실행

enter image description here

전에 모듈이 존재하지

enter image description here

않는 말을하지 않습니다.

답변

0

이 프로젝트의 프로젝트 인터프리터가 시스템 파이썬을 사용하도록 구성해야합니다. The JetBrains documentation for doing this is here. IntelliJ에서는 기본적으로 프로젝트 구조 설정으로 이동하여 프로젝트 또는 모듈에 필요한 Python SDK (필요한 경우)를 구성해야합니다. 1


당신이 인 IntelliJ보다 다른 JetBrains의 IDE를 사용하는 경우 1 개 지침에 따라 다르지만, 이것은 당신이 당신의 질문에 지정된 것입니다.

+0

그러나 SDK에서는 위에서 지정한 클래스 경로를 적용했습니다. 그리고 그 문제는 해결 될 것으로 보입니다. 프로그램을 실행하기 전에 라이브러리를 인식합니다. 실행하려고 할 때만 작동하지 않습니다. – Shlomi

+0

IntelliJ 또는 명령 줄/도구 외부에서 실행 했습니까? – Dan

+0

Intellij 통해. – Shlomi